Kathleen Rose Brown was born November 13, 1934 in Benton County, Minnesota to Andrew and Leona (Fischer) Wassel. She married David Brown on September 9, 1958 at St. Elizabeth’s Catholic Church in Brennyville. She lived and raised her family near Morrill most of her life. Kathleen loved taking pictures, often with more than one camera, scrap booking; saving newspaper clippings; genealogy; spending time on her computer and playing cards. She was an active member of St. Joseph’s Catholic Church where she was instrumental in starting the St. Joseph’s Prayer Line. She was a member of the St. Joseph’s Christian Mothers, St. Jude’s Mission Group and a funeral lunch volunteer for many years.
